Job Title: Pharmacy Technician-PBRJob Description
As a Pharmacy Technician-PBR, you will be responsible for ensuring accurate prescription insurance information is entered into patient profiles by processing eligibility checks and adjudicating pharmacy claims. You will communicate with providers regarding medication prior authorizations and serve as a resource during the process. Additionally, you will handle inquiries from patients, clients, physicians, and clinics, and manage patient refill coordination to ensure compliance with therapy plans.
Responsibilities
- Process eligibility checks and adjudicate pharmacy claims.
- Troubleshoot claim rejections and communicate correct information to patients.
- Communicate the need for medication prior authorization to providers.
- Manage inbound calls regarding order status, services, and financial support.
- Serve as a technical resource for adjudication and identify improvement areas.
- Enter detailed and accurate progress notes for patient profiles.
- Contact patients to schedule medication delivery and payment.
- Ensure patient compliance with therapy plans through refill coordination.
- Identify and report adverse events and product complaints to clinicians.
